Does anyone know how to make multiplying balls out of golf balls?

I suppose this may seem like I'm asking for a secret so I will re phrase my question.

Does anyone know how to stretch golf ball casing?

I made some shells with Bondo. You have to wax the ball before you apply the Bondo, otherwise it will not come off the ball. After it dries you sand to finish and paint. I am not sure how the dimples would turn out you could use a Dremal tool.

I saw a site on vacuum forming and you could use your oven and a shop vac.
